So let's start first with the silent letters in some words. Okay, take a look at these words.

I'll try to read them please. Good. Can you guess what letter should be completely silent from these words? That's right, the L. So we should be saying for these words, half, walk, talk. And of course, would, should and could if you're not pronouncing these letters, these words correctly if you're saying world For example, You should pay a lot of attention and immediately start correcting the sounds. Words like wood and crude are words that you will be using thousands of times in your life.

Every time you speak English, you'll be using these words. So if you're pronouncing them mistakenly, you're making it confusing to people to understand you every time you say something in English, so remember half talk, walk and could should put try to say it like that could shoot for great. Okay, next silent letter. Look at these words. Try to pronounce them Can you guess which sound we are eliminating? If you said the letter B you're perfectly right so when we say this word we should be saying bomb makes it a lot easier doesn't it?

Instead of saying bomba Jesus a bomb this one should be That's right. Climb and when you do your hair you do it with that calm right calm Excellent. So when you have an M and a beat together completely forget about the beat. Just pronounce. Calm bomb. Okay, got it.

Now let's take a look at another easy one. Look at these words I try to read them I think you can tell me which sound or which letter is completely silent. Right? Right, we should say the light or bright. Whenever you see a G and an H, it never sounds like a G. Okay? In this case it's completely silent.

Ignore the G and the H words like light or bright. Okay, now a very important part.
